the QSDs are nice speakers, and the Hex speakers are nice as well...
they are a different sounding set of comps, and I am not sure if someone who prefers the Quart sound would really like the Hex sound...they are both awesome speakers, but it boils down to personal taste...I for one am not a huge fan of the Quarts, but I prefer a different style of sound, and I cant knock Quarts speakers, because they are a really good speaker when all is said and done...
